In the startup group on Windows Vista, I have MCEBuddy Taskbar Monitor. This was setup as part of the the installation routine. Each time Vista starts, the UAC prompt appears asking if it is okay to start the application. It seems like the prompt should not appear - did something not install correctly?
Yes, it should appear as the monitor utility needs to be able to start and stop the MCEBuddy service (an administrative priv). However, the monitor util does not need to be running for MCEBuddy to work. if it bothers you, just delete the shortcut from the startup menu. In MCEBuddy 2.0 we are changing things so the service does not need to be started and stopped, which also also allows MCE and other plug ins to work better,
